Materials information

Materials Type of material
Chalcopyrite Ore
Gold Ore
Pyrite Ore

Host and associated rocks

  • Host or associated Associated
    Rock type Plutonic Rock > Mafic Intrusive Rock > Diorite
    Stratigraphic age (youngest) Late Jurassic
  • Host or associated Associated
    Rock type Metamorphic Rock > Serpentinite
  • Host or associated Host
    Rock type Metamorphic Rock > Metavolcanic Rock > Mafic Metamorphic Rock > Greenstone

Nearby scientific data

(1) Volcanic rocks

Economic information

Ore body information

  • General form OVERLAPPING QUARTZ LENS
    Strike N70-80E
    Dip 60-70 SE
    Width 2.44M

Comments on the geologic information

  • MAY BE ON NORTHEAST EXTENSION OF THE SILVER PEAK MINERALIZED ZONE.
